Notes
Suzan went to the village to monitor the level of sustainability of the healthy and safe kitchen program, and when she got there,she met a few members gathered at the meeting place who warmly welcomed her to the village. After exchanging greetings and having a few discussions about the activity of the day, together they agreed and walked around the lower and upper side of the village while monitoring the program facilities. Most homes had improved on their sanitation and hygiene such as the bathrooms,latrines,kitchens, dish racks which were repaired and well smeared. The stoves were used effectively and the members reported to no longer suffer from smoke inhalation and other heart diseases. They also said that the stove cooked so fast and used very little firewood for cooking. This was so encouraging to hear and to see that the entire community accepted change and prefers to live a healthy life. Suzan requested the program committee leaders to always monitor other members who hadn’t improved on their facilities and keep encouraging them to do so, so as to live a healthy life with their families. The members thanked Suzan for the advice given and promised to maintain their sanitation and hygiene as much as possible. The meeting then came to an end with the community wishing Suzan a safe journey back home.
